Present Day Aspect and Character


St Mary's Church

end is a large village which is essentially made up of recent decades' housing bordering the Woking-Clandon Road. The photographs chosen on this page show the prettiest views in the area, but are not typical of the rather more mundane central area. The few shops in the village and the recreation ground represent the modern centre of Send, but the more expected traditional centre, around the church, is in fact very remote.  At some distance to the south west St Mary's Church stands rather isolated with only one large house and farm forming the group.  However, this is a most attractive spot bordering the banks of the River Wey amidst rolling fields and it is certainly worth discovering.  


Sendcourt Farm, view from the church 

As a point of interest across the fields to the south are the grounds to Sutton Place, one of Surrey's most important historic houses, which also just happens to be over the Borough boundary in Woking.   To the north along Potters Lane there is further delightful countryside leading to Cartbridge where the A247 emerges to cross above the River Wey.   Mostly to the east of Send there are several inland lakes made out of disused excavation works, some have given way to the use of sailing clubs.  

This generally low lying area encourages a dampness of the land and the flat terrain here probably accounts for the name of Send's closest neighbour at Send Marsh.


The Manor House at Send Marsh

In Send Marsh to the north east of the main village is the majestic Manor House, a three-storey red brick 17th century property facing a tiny green and dwarfing other surrounding homes.

Public Houses
The Saddlers Arms, Send Marsh Road is set in the quiet village of Send Marsh.  The building is more than 400 years old and was originally a saddlers workshop. Tel: 01483 224209
